Skip to content
  • diy wordpress website design for small business
  • diy wordpress website design for small business
Website Research Service, affordable website design packages,small business web design packages, affordable web design companyWebsite Research Service, affordable website design packages,small business web design packages, affordable web design company
  • 外贸独立站
  • SEO策略
  • Plan
  • Blog
  • About
  • Contact
Question

Add a Login Button to Your WordPress Homepage Easily

Posted on May 26, 2025 by William Zheng

Are you looking to streamline access to your WordPress site? Adding a login button to your homepage can enhance user experience and encourage return visits. This simple yet effective feature allows users to log in quickly, making it easier for them to engage with your content or services.

In this article, we’ll guide you through the steps to add a login button to your WordPress homepage. We’ll cover various methods, tips for customization, and insights to ensure it blends seamlessly with your site’s design. Let’s get started!

Related Video

How to Add a Login Button to Your WordPress Homepage

Adding a login button to your WordPress homepage can enhance user experience and make it easier for your visitors to access their accounts. In this guide, we will break down the process into simple steps, allowing you to integrate this feature seamlessly.

Why Add a Login Button?


Adding Register, Login, Logout Links to WordPress Menu - add a login button to your wordpress homepage

A login button on your homepage serves several important purposes:

  • User Convenience: It allows users to quickly access their accounts without navigating through multiple pages.
  • Increased Engagement: Users are more likely to log in if the option is readily available.
  • Enhanced Security: Direct login links can help users log in securely, reducing the chances of phishing attempts.

Steps to Add a Login Button to Your WordPress Homepage

There are several methods to add a login button to your WordPress homepage. Below, we’ll cover two of the most common and effective methods: using a shortcode and editing your theme’s files.

Method 1: Using a Shortcode

  1. Install a Plugin: To use shortcodes for your login button, you may need a plugin like “Theme My Login” or “WPForms”.
  2. Go to your WordPress dashboard.
  3. Navigate to Plugins > Add New.
  4. Search for your chosen plugin, install, and activate it.

  5. Create a Login Form:

  6. Once the plugin is active, go to the plugin settings to create a login form.
  7. Customize the form settings as needed.

  8. Get the Shortcode:

  9. The plugin will provide you with a shortcode. It usually looks something like [theme-my-login] or [wpforms id="123"].

  10. Add the Shortcode to Your Homepage:

  11. Navigate to Pages > All Pages and select your homepage.
  12. In the page editor, paste the shortcode where you want the login button to appear.
  13. Update the page.


Adding A Login Link To A Button In WordPress - ThemeWaves - add a login button to your wordpress homepage

  1. Style the Button (Optional):
  2. You can add custom CSS to style the button to match your site’s theme.

Method 2: Manually Adding the Button in the Theme

If you prefer not to use a plugin, you can manually add a login button in your theme files.

  1. Edit the Theme Files:
  2. Go to your WordPress dashboard.
  3. Navigate to Appearance > Theme Editor.
  4. Find the header.php or footer.php file, depending on where you want the button to appear.

  5. Add the HTML for the Button:

  6. Insert the following HTML where you want the login button to show up:
    html
    " class="login-button">Login
  7. This code generates a link to the WordPress login page.

  8. Style the Button:

  9. Add custom CSS to your theme’s style sheet to make the button visually appealing. For example:
    css
    .login-button {
    background-color: #0073aa;
    color: white;
    padding: 10px 20px;
    text-decoration: none;
    border-radius: 5px;
    }

  10. Save Changes:

  11. After editing, make sure to save your changes.

Benefits of Adding a Login Button

  • Accessibility: A login button provides easy access for returning visitors.
  • User Retention: Quick access to accounts encourages users to return.
  • Professional Appearance: A well-placed login button enhances the professional look of your site.


How to add a login button to your WordPress homepage - add a login button to your wordpress homepage

Challenges You Might Face

  • Theme Compatibility: Some themes may have specific configurations that affect how buttons are displayed.
  • Responsive Design: Ensure that the button looks good on both desktop and mobile devices.
  • Plugin Conflicts: If using a plugin, ensure it does not conflict with other plugins or themes.

Practical Tips for Success

  • Test the Button: After adding the button, test it on different devices and browsers to ensure it works properly.
  • Use Clear Labels: Make sure the button is clearly labeled as “Login” to avoid confusion.
  • Monitor User Feedback: Pay attention to user feedback regarding the button’s visibility and functionality.

Cost Considerations

Adding a login button to your WordPress homepage is generally free, especially if you use the manual method. However, if you opt for premium plugins, costs may vary. Here are some potential costs to consider:

  • Plugin Costs: Some advanced plugins may require a one-time fee or a subscription.
  • Custom Development: If you hire a developer, costs can vary based on their rates.

Conclusion

Integrating a login button on your WordPress homepage is a straightforward process that can significantly enhance user experience. Whether you choose to use a plugin or manually add it through your theme files, following the steps outlined above will help you achieve this goal.

With a little effort, you can create a welcoming environment for your users, encouraging them to engage more with your site.

Frequently Asked Questions (FAQs)

1. Can I add a login button without coding?**
Yes, using a plugin is a simple way to add a login button without needing to code.

2. Will adding a login button slow down my website?**
No, if implemented correctly, adding a login button should not noticeably affect your website’s speed.

3. What if I want to customize the login page?**
You can customize the login page using plugins like “Custom Login Page Customizer” or through custom code.

4. Is it safe to use plugins for login functionality?**
Yes, as long as you choose reputable and well-maintained plugins, they are generally safe to use.

5. Can I add a logout button as well?**
Yes, you can add a logout button using a similar method by linking to the wp_logout_url() function.

Post Views: 16
This entry was posted in Question and tagged add login form, homepage customization, how to add a login button to your wordpress homepage, WordPress login button.
Unlock Free SEO APIs for Enhanced Digital Marketing
Mastering Correction Email Subject Lines
Copyright 2007-2025 © [email protected]
  • About
  • Contact
  • Privacy Terms
  • 外贸独立站
  • SEO策略
  • Plan
  • Blog
  • About
  • Contact